Children's Early Ability to Solve Perspective-Taking Problems.
Newcombe, Nora; Huttenlocher, Janellen
Developmental Psychology, v28 n4 p635-43 Jul 1992
In four experiments, three, four, and five year olds were successful in solving perspective-taking problems when they were asked what object occupied a specified location with respect to a hypothetical observer. Results indicated developmental change in several important aspects of spatial performance. (BC)
